About John Ashurst

John Ashurst is a scholar working on Surgery, Infectious Diseases,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Epidemiology and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, having authored 82 papers that have together received 597 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Diversity and Career in Medicine (7 papers), Health and Medical Research Impacts (5 papers), Cardiac Structural Anomalies and Repair (4 papers), Pneumonia and Respiratory Infections (3 papers), Neonatal Health and Biochemistry (3 papers),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(3 papers), SARS-CoV-2 and COVID-19 Research (3 papers) and Methemoglobinemia and Tumor Lysis Syndrome (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Gender Studies (45 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(111 cit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(84 citations), Infectious Diseases (54 citations) and Emergency Medicine (25 citations). John Ashurst has collaborated with scholars based in United States, India and Peru. Frequent co-authors include Megan Wasson, Matthew D. Cook, Anthony Santarelli, Richard L. Lammers, Stephen Lee, Muhammad Atif Ameer, Scott L. Taylor, Bryan G Kane, Kevin Weaver and Jason Wang. Their work appears in journals such as Western Journal of Emergency Medicine, The American Journal of Emergency Medicine, Academic Emergency Medicine, The Journal of the American Osteopathic Association and Journal of Osteopathic Medicine.
